VMware上搭建Linux版MySQL指南
vmware linux mysql

首页 2024-12-26 13:27:02



VMware、Linux 与 MySQL:构建高效数据库解决方案的强强联合 在当今信息化高速发展的时代,企业对于数据存储、处理及分析的需求日益增长

    为了满足这些需求,构建一个高效、稳定且可扩展的数据库解决方案成为了众多企业的首要任务

    在这一背景下,VMware、Linux与MySQL的组合凭借其卓越的性能、灵活的部署方式以及广泛的社区支持,成为了众多企业的首选

    本文将深入探讨这一组合的优势,以及如何有效利用它们来构建强大的数据库环境

     一、VMware:虚拟化技术的领航者 VMware,作为全球领先的虚拟化软件提供商,通过其创新的虚拟化解决方案,彻底改变了IT基础设施的架构方式

    虚拟化技术允许在同一物理硬件上运行多个操作系统实例(虚拟机),从而极大地提高了资源利用率、降低了运营成本,并增强了系统的灵活性和可扩展性

     1. 资源优化与成本节约 在VMware平台上,企业可以轻松实现服务器的整合,将多个物理服务器上的工作负载迁移到少数几台高性能的物理服务器上运行

    这种集中化管理不仅减少了硬件需求,还通过动态资源分配(如VMware的DRS功能)进一步优化了资源使用,有效降低了电力消耗、冷却成本和硬件维护费用

     2. 高可用性与灾难恢复 VMware提供了强大的高可用性和灾难恢复解决方案,如VMware HighAvailability (HA) 和VMware Site RecoveryManager (SRM)

    这些功能确保了数据库服务的连续性,即使遇到硬件故障或自然灾害,也能迅速恢复服务,保障业务不中断

     3. 灵活部署与快速响应 借助VMware的虚拟化技术,企业可以快速部署新的数据库环境,无论是测试环境还是生产环境,都能在短时间内完成配置和上线

    这种灵活性使得企业能够更快地响应市场变化,抓住商业机会

     二、Linux:稳定、开源的操作系统基石 Linux,作为开源操作系统的典范,以其高度的稳定性、强大的安全性和丰富的开源生态,成为了服务器领域的首选操作系统

    对于运行MySQL数据库而言,Linux提供了理想的运行环境

     1. 高稳定性与安全性 Linux系统以其卓越的稳定性著称,能够长时间无故障运行,这对于需要24小时不间断服务的数据库系统至关重要

    同时,Linux的开源特性意味着其安全性得到了全球众多开发者和安全专家的持续关注与改进,使得它成为抵御网络攻击的强大防线

     2. 丰富的软件资源 Linux拥有丰富的软件库,几乎涵盖了所有数据库管理所需的工具和软件,包括MySQL本身

    此外,Linux还支持多种编程语言,为开发者和数据库管理员提供了极大的便利

     3. 成本效益 Linux的开源性质意味着企业无需支付高昂的许可费用,这对于预算有限但又追求高性能的企业来说,无疑是一个巨大的优势

    同时,Linux社区的活跃也意味着企业可以获得持续的更新和技术支持

     三、MySQL:高效、可靠的开源数据库 MySQL,作为最流行的开源关系型数据库管理系统之一,以其高性能、易用性和灵活性,成为了众多Web应用和中小型企业的首选

     1. 高性能与可扩展性 MySQL经过优化,能够处理大量并发连接和复杂查询,即使在资源有限的环境下也能保持高效运行

    其内置的InnoDB存储引擎更是以其高可靠性和高性能赢得了广泛好评

    此外,MySQL支持水平扩展和垂直扩展,可以根据业务需求灵活调整数据库规模

     2. 丰富的功能与灵活性 MySQL提供了丰富的SQL功能,支持事务处理、存储过程、触发器等多种高级数据库操作

    同时,MySQL还支持多种编程语言接口,如PHP、Python、Java等,便于集成到各种应用程序中

     3. 开源社区的支持 MySQL拥有一个庞大的开源社区,这意味着企业可以从中获得丰富的文档、教程、插件和第三方工具,以及来自全球开发者的技术支持

    此外,MySQL的开源特性也促进了其快速迭代和创新,确保了技术的持续进步

     四、VMware、Linux与MySQL的强强联合 将VMware、Linux与MySQL三者结合,可以构建出一个既高效又可靠的数据库解决方案

    VMware的虚拟化技术提供了灵活的资源管理和高可用性的基础架构;Linux作为操作系统,提供了稳定、安全的运行环境;而MySQL则以其高效的数据处理能力,满足了企业对数据存储和查询的需求

     1. 部署与运维优化 在VMware平台上部署Linux虚拟机,并在其上安装MySQL数据库,可以实现资源的动态分配和高效利用

    同时,VMware的vSphere管理工具使得运维人员可以集中管理所有虚拟机,简化了运维流程,提高了工作效率

     2. 灾备与数据保护 利用VMware的HA和SRM功能,可以构建出完善的灾备方案,确保MySQL数据库在遭遇故障时能够迅速恢复,保障数据的完整性和业务的连续性

     3. 性能调优与扩展 结合Linux的性能调优工具和MySQL的性能监控与优化功能,可以实时监控数据库性能,及时发现并解决潜在问题

    同时,随着业务需求的增长,可以通过增加虚拟机或升级硬件资源的方式,轻松实现数据库的扩展

     五、结论 综上所述,VMware、Linux与MySQL的组合为企业构建高效、稳定且可扩展的数据库解决方案提供了强有力的支持

    这一组合不仅优化了资源利用,降低了运营成本,还提升了系统的灵活性和安全性

    在未来的信息化建设中,随着技术的不断进步和应用场景的不断拓展,VMware、Linux与MySQL的组合将继续发挥其独特优势,为企业创造更大的价值

    因此,对于追求高性能、高可用性和成本效益的企业而言,选择这一组合无疑是一个明智的决策

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道